from cbsnews.com: Kraft is removing artificial preservatives from its most popular individually wrapped cheese slices, in the latest sign that companies are tweaking their recipes as food labels come under greater scrutiny. The change affects the company’s Kraft Singles in the full-fat American and White American varieties, which Kraft says account for the majority of the brand’s sales. Sorbic acid is being replaced by natamycin, which Kraft says is a “natural mold inhibitor.“… Last week, Subway said it was removing a chemical from its bread after a popular food blogger named Vani Hari started a petition noting the ingredient is also used in yoga mats.
